PURPOSE: To improve the efficiency of generating the bubble for cleaning by providing a mixing diffusion part mixing the detergent with the air at diffusion and a housing room which houses the multipore body and forming a drawing part on the mixing diffusion room and a discharge drawing part in a housing room.
CONSTITUTION: One end of a detergent supply tube 2 which supplies the detergent and one end of an air supply tube 3 which supplies the air are connected to one end of a bubble generator 1. A bubble discharge port 4 which ejects the generated bubble is formed on the other end. The bubble generator 1 is provided with a mixing diffusion room 5 mixing the detergent and the air at the diffusion and a housing room 6 wider than the room 5. A multipore body 8 consisting of plural metal nets 7 is housed in the housing room 6. The rooms 5 and 6 are connected by a narrow drawing part 10 formed on the bubble generator 1. Further, a drawing part 11 for discharge which is gradually reduced from the housing room 6 to the bubble discharge port 4 is formed. The port 4 is connected to a pipe 12 for bubble through which the ejected bubble flows.
